Transaction 26cdcb61c239b6b96111dbe011ed3926de30200a0a8a08bc5903b0098b2ba040
1 Input
1 Output
-
26cdcb61c239b6b96111dbe011ed3926de30200a0a8a08bc5903b0098b2ba040:0
- value
- 2354513
- script pubkey
- OP_0 OP_PUSHBYTES_20 f52c55b816bf3776b2015c272b286c0d3d19c123
- address
- bc1q75k9twqkhumhdvsptsnjk2rvp573nsfrkp0pw0